Monosodium Phosphate (MSP) Anhydrous

Monosodium Phosphate (MSP) Anhydrous

Product Overview:


Identification of Substance: sodium dihydrogenorthophosphate

CAS #: 7558-80-7

Monosodium phosphate (MSP) is a soluble sodium phosphate compound used across food, water treatment, and fertilizer applications. It is commonly employed as a pH buffering and sequestering agent in food and beverage processing, stabilizing acidity and preventing off-flavors in processed products. Additionally, it serves as a boiler water treatment additive, helping control scale formation and maintain proper alkalinity in industrial steam systems. MSP is also utilized in fertilizer formulations requiring a soluble, acidic phosphate source. Furthermore, it finds applications in general chemical manufacturing processes requiring a food-grade phosphate salt.

Monopotassium Phosphate (MKP)

Monopotassium Phosphate (MKP)

Product Overview:


Identification of Substance: potassium dihydrogen phosphate

CAS #: 7778-77-0

Monopotassium phosphate (MKP) is a highly soluble, chloride-free source of phosphorus and potassium used across fertilizer, food, and fire protection applications. It is commonly employed in foliar feeding and fertigation programs, delivering rapid nutrient uptake for phosphorus- and potassium-demanding crop growth stages such as flowering and fruiting. Additionally, it serves as a food additive for buffering and nutrient fortification in processed food and beverage products. MKP is also utilized as a component in fire extinguisher powder formulations due to its flame-suppressing chemistry. Furthermore, it finds applications in hydroponic and specialty crop nutrition programs requiring a pure, chloride-free nutrient source.

Monoethanolamine (MEA) 99%

Monoethanolamine (MEA) 99%

Product Overview:


CAS # 141-43-5

Monoethanolamine (MEA) at 99% purity is a widely used alkanolamine found across upstream, midstream, downstream, and construction applications. It is commonly employed in gas sweetening processes to remove carbon dioxide and hydrogen sulfide from natural gas and refinery streams, protecting downstream equipment from corrosion and meeting pipeline specifications. Additionally, it serves as a surfactant and cosmetic intermediate used in cleaning product and personal care manufacturing. MEA is also utilized as a corrosion inhibitor in process fluid formulations and as a grinding aid additive in cement and construction material manufacturing. Furthermore, it finds applications in general chemical manufacturing processes requiring a versatile alkanolamine.

Monoammonium Phosphate (MAP)

Monoammonium Phosphate (MAP)

Product Overview:


Identification of Substance: ammonium dihydrogenorthophosphate

CAS #: 7722-76-1

Monoammonium phosphate (MAP) is one of the most widely used starter fertilizers in modern agriculture. It is commonly employed to supply nitrogen and phosphorus at the time of planting, supporting rapid root establishment and early crop growth. Additionally, it serves as the primary active ingredient in ABC dry chemical fire extinguisher powder, where it forms a barrier that smothers and interrupts combustion when heated. MAP is also utilized as a food additive for leavening and pH buffering in baked goods. Furthermore, it finds applications in specialty blended fertilizer manufacturing requiring a high-analysis, water-soluble phosphate source.

Manganese Oxide 60%

Manganese Oxide 60%

Product Overview:


CAS #: 1344-43-0

Manganese oxide at 60% concentration is used across fertilizer, animal feed, water treatment, and ceramics manufacturing applications. It is commonly employed as a manganese micronutrient source in fertilizer and animal feed formulations, correcting deficiencies affecting plant and animal health. Additionally, it serves as a filter media component in water treatment systems designed for iron and manganese removal from municipal and well water supplies. Manganese oxide is also utilized as a raw material in ceramics and pigment manufacturing, contributing color and functional properties to finished products. Furthermore, it finds applications in general chemical manufacturing processes requiring a stable manganese oxide source.

Manganese Sulfate Monohydrate

Manganese Monohydrate Sulfate

Product Overview:


CAS #: 10034-96-5

Manganese sulfate monohydrate (granular) is a free-flowing manganese compound used across fertilizer, animal feed, and water treatment applications. It is commonly employed as a manganese micronutrient source in fertilizer programs, correcting deficiencies that impair photosynthesis and enzyme function in crops. Additionally, it serves as a mineral supplement in animal feed premixes, supporting overall livestock nutrition. Manganese sulfate monohydrate is also utilized in water treatment systems as a media regeneration agent for iron and manganese removal filters. Furthermore, it finds applications in blended fertilizer manufacturing requiring a granular, low-dust manganese product.

Manganese Chloride

Manganese Chloride Anhydrous

Product Overview:


Identification of Substance: Manganese dichloride

CAS #: 7773-01-5

Manganese chloride is a soluble manganese salt used across animal feed, fertilizer, and specialty chemical manufacturing applications. It is commonly employed as a manganese source in animal feed and fertilizer micronutrient blends, correcting deficiencies that impact plant enzyme function and animal metabolic health. Additionally, it serves as a catalyst in various organic synthesis reactions within the chemical manufacturing industry. Manganese chloride is also utilized in the manufacture of dry-cell batteries and other specialty chemical products requiring a soluble manganese source. Furthermore, it finds applications in general industrial processes requiring a readily available manganese ion source.

Manganese Carbonate

Manganese Carbonate

Product Overview:


CAS #: 598-62-9

Manganese carbonate is a controlled-solubility manganese compound used across animal feed, fertilizer, and chemical manufacturing applications. It is commonly employed as a manganese micronutrient source in animal feed premixes and fertilizer formulations, supporting enzyme function and photosynthesis in plants and metabolic health in livestock. Additionally, it serves as a precursor in the manufacture of manganese oxide, specialty pigments, and catalysts used in various industrial processes. Manganese carbonate is also utilized in slow-release mineral nutrition applications where controlled solubility is a formulation advantage. Furthermore, it finds applications in general chemical manufacturing processes requiring a stable manganese raw material.

Maleic Anhydride

Maleic Anhydride

Product Overview:


Identification of Substance: 2,5-Furandione

CAS #: 108-31-6

Maleic anhydride is a key chemical intermediate used extensively across resin, coatings, and construction manufacturing. It is commonly employed in the production of unsaturated polyester resins used in fiberglass-reinforced construction, marine, and automotive applications. Additionally, it serves as a raw material for alkyd resins used in paints and coatings, contributing to gloss, durability, and weather resistance. Maleic anhydride is also utilized in the manufacture of lubricant additives that improve oxidative stability in industrial and automotive lubricants. Furthermore, it finds applications as a building block for agrochemicals and specialty copolymers used across the broader chemical manufacturing industry.

Magnesium Sulfate Monohydrate

Magnesium Sulfate Monohydrate

(Powder and Granular)

Product Overview:


Identification of Substance: sulfuric acid magnesium salt (1:1), monohydrate

CAS #: 14168-73-1

Magnesium sulfate monohydrate is a compact, low-moisture magnesium and sulfur source used across fertilizer and animal feed manufacturing applications. It is commonly employed in fertilizer blending programs, where its reduced water content makes it well suited for producing stable, free-flowing granular fertilizer products. Additionally, it serves as a mineral supplement in animal feed premixes, supporting overall livestock nutrition and metabolic health. Magnesium sulfate monohydrate is also utilized in specialty fertilizer manufacturing requiring precise magnesium and sulfur ratios. Furthermore, it finds applications in general chemical manufacturing processes requiring a concentrated, low-moisture magnesium salt.
